# Environments — PulseVane Config Hot-Reload

PulseVane watches its config tree and applies changes without restart. Staging reloads on every write; production debounces for 30s and rejects unsigned bundles. Reload events are logged with a checksum of the applied tree. Security note: hot-reload bypasses the deploy pipeline, so audit the watcher's write ACLs per environment. Only the ops group may modify the watched path. The current production values are as follows.

deployment values, kajep-kageg:
[praix]
host = praix.paliqcorp.corp
user = praix_svc
database = praix_prod

Handover: Quillrelay broker upgrade, v4 to v5. Plugin authors: topic auto-creation is now off; declare queues explicitly. Wire format unchanged, but heartbeat interval drops to 15s — update your clients or they'll be dropped. Staging broker on the Dunmoor cluster is already on v5; test there first. Admin console credentials rotated during the upgrade. To re-enroll your plugin's service account, the console prompts once for the recovery passphrase shown below.

unlock words, yawig-kagef: gordor-holvan-ulaael-pramir-ulaiel-tamdor

## Break-glass access — Huewarden contrast audit

Plugin authors: normally you can't touch the raw audit pipeline, and that's on purpose. But if a contrast regression ships to production and the Pallion dashboard is down, you can break glass. This grants 30 minutes of write access to the audit ruleset — every action is logged, so don't get creative. To open the break-glass locker, enter the recovery passphrase below.

vault phrase of taweg-kafof = oliax-zorael

Handover — Brambleforge Build Migration

To support: I've moved the Orchardware build onto the hermetic Brambleforge system. Legacy builds still work via the fallback runner, but only until next quarter. If the hermetic cache corrupts, drain it from the recovery console and rebuild from scratch. That console sits outside normal auth and needs the recovery passphrase noted below.

unlock words, faweg-fahop: wendor-kelmir-ulaeth-holael